**14:32 — Audit findings triaged.** The Lumenfold contrast audit flagged 23 components below the 4.5:1 threshold, mostly in the Harbinger dashboard's muted-gray palette. Priya's team patched the token set and reran the checker twice before sign-off. Future maintainers should rerun the audit after any theme change. The remediation build that closed this incident is recorded below.

session token of tadug-bagep = htk9_7d92de289

Hi Soraya — taking over the snapshot testing cleanup for the Pellwood component library. I regenerated baselines for the button and modal suites after the font change; the table suite still shows a one-pixel border diff I haven't root-caused. Nothing blocks the Friday release, but flag it in the notes. For regression questions, contact the frontend tooling desk.

pager mailbox: druwyn@norvaio.corp

v3.8.2 — Key rotation for Tollgrave, the shipping-fee rules engine. Previous signing key retired after the Q3 audit flagged its age. All rule bundles published after this release must be verified against the new key; older bundles remain valid until month end. No rule logic changed. Release managers must update their verification config with the key below.

rollout seal: bky4_x7Gc

Ticket — missed pick-up, notarised deed. Courier from Swiftmere Runners failed to collect the Alderton deed from the Penrow office yesterday. Document remains in the manager's safe, seal intact. Rebook for first slot tomorrow; same driver preferred. Registry deadline is Friday, no slack left. When the replacement courier arrives, relay the hand-over instruction given below.

courier memo of tawep-tajep: the quenius ulaiel courier leaves the fenir ledger at gate 9128 under passcode 527513

# Artifact Signing — RouteAllot Heuristic Service

RouteAllot (driver-assignment heuristic) ships as a signed tarball. Build on the sealed runner, never locally. Verify the heuristic weights checksum before packaging; mismatches mean a stale training snapshot. Sign with the release manager's key only — team keys were revoked last quarter. Rotate after every major version. Upload to the Garnholt artifact store within one hour of signing or the pipeline marks the build stale. The current release signing key is as follows.

deploy key for kajof-fajop: bky6_gDHw9Q